DDR Leben Plattform
| public | ||
| src | ||
| .gitignore | ||
| AGENTS.md | ||
| CLAUDE.md | ||
| eslint.config.mjs | ||
| next.config.ts | ||
| package-lock.json | ||
| package.json | ||
| postcss.config.mjs | ||
| README.md | ||
| tsconfig.json | ||
DDR Leben
Privates Grundgerüst für die Plattform DDR Leben.
Stack
- Next.js
- TypeScript
- App Router
- Tailwind CSS
- Forgejo
- Coolify
- Supabase-ready
Struktur
src/app/[locale]– öffentliche zweisprachige Oberflächesrc/app/[locale]/mitglied– Mitgliederbereichsrc/app/[locale]/cms– Moderator/Admin-Backofficesrc/app/api/health– einfacher Healthchecksrc/lib/i18n.ts– Locales und Copysrc/lib/roles.ts– Rollen-Grundlagesrc/lib/supabase/browser.ts– Browser-Client-Basis
Nächste Schritte
- Supabase-Projekt anlegen
- Auth- und Rollenmodell aufsetzen
- Public / Mitglied / Moderator / Admin serverseitig absichern
- CMS- und Erlebnisarchitektur ausbauen